Transaction 1bfe0e2caa84f84e6492f634878ff43638c4eb8e8a54dd950e1238a4b23bc880

19 Input
1 Outputs
  • 1bfe0e2caa84f84e6492f634878ff43638c4eb8e8a54dd950e1238a4b23bc880:0
  • value  20838107
    address  3DH8TBUmZacjJkQ7M6ZZqSRDHQLGcxvHyA